Posted by James van Buskirk at c.l.f:
http://groups.google.com/group/comp.lang.fortran/browse_thread/thread/4fbe901275607684
module m
implicit none
type t
integer i
end type t
end module m
module n
use m, only: a=>t
implicit none
private
public a
end module n
module oh
use n
use n, only: b=>a
implicit none
private
public a, b
end module oh
>gfortran -c bug1.f90
bug1.f90:20.11:
public a, b
1
Error: Symbol 'a' at (1) has no IMPLICIT type
The thread contains some more test cases. All of them should be checked.

The program in comment 0 looks wrong to me:
use n
use n, only: b=>a
does not import "a" per paragraph 7 of Fortran 2008's "11.2.2
The USE statement and use association".
Thus, gfortran rightly complains about:
public a, b
1
Error: Symbol 'a' at (1) has no IMPLICIT type
In the thread, the example "bug1b.f90" (date: Jan 5, 7:36 am) is the same as PR
51578. All other examples are - valid or invalid - correctly handled by
gfortran.
Thus, I mark this PR as duplicate of PR 51578.
